Understanding the Goethe B1 Certification: A Gateway to Intermediate German Proficiency
The Goethe B1 certification stands as a considerable milestone in the journey of learning German. Recognized worldwide, this accreditation not only verifies a student's intermediate proficiency in the German language however also opens doors to numerous scholastic and expert chances. This short article explores the intricacies of the Goethe B1 exam, its importance, and how to get ready for it effectively.
What is the Goethe B1 Certification?
The Goethe B1 is a language certificate offered by the Goethe-Institut, a renowned cultural organization that promotes the German language and culture worldwide. This certification is designed to assess a student's ability to communicate effectively in German at an intermediate level. It is based upon the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R), which categorizes language proficiency into 6 levels: A1, A2, B1, B2, C1, and C2 Zertifikat. The B1 level is the third action in this framework, indicating that the student can understand the bottom lines of clear standard input and can interact in basic and routine tasks.
Value of the Goethe B1 Certification
Academic Advancement: Many universities and universities in German-speaking countries need a B1 level accreditation for admission to undergraduate and graduate programs. It demonstrates that the student has the necessary language skills to follow lectures and take part in academic conversations.
Professional Opportunities: For individuals aiming to operate in German-speaking countries, the Goethe B1 accreditation is often a prerequisite for particular tasks. It reveals companies that the prospect can deal with everyday communication and perform tasks that need an excellent command of the language.
Personal Development: Achieving the B1 level is a considerable personal achievement. It increases self-confidence and offers a solid foundation for additional language knowing. It likewise opens up chances for travel, cultural exchange, and personal growth.
Structure of the Goethe B1 Exam
The Goethe B1 exam includes 4 areas, each developed to test various language abilities:
Reading Comprehension (Leseverstehen)
Format: Multiple-choice questions, matching tasks, and gap-filling workouts.Period: 60 minutes.Goal: To evaluate the capability to comprehend and analyze numerous composed texts, including posts, letters, and brief stories.
Listening Comprehension (Hörverstehen)
Format: Multiple-choice concerns, matching tasks, and gap-filling workouts.Period: 30 minutes.Goal: To evaluate the ability to understand spoken German in different contexts, such as discussions, announcements, and interviews.
Composing (Schriftlicher Ausdruck)
Format: Writing a letter, e-mail, or brief essay.Duration: 45 minutes.Objective: To assess the ability to express ideas and concepts in written kind, utilizing appropriate vocabulary and grammar.
Speaking (Mündlicher Ausdruck)

Language Courses: Enrolling in a structured German language course can offer a comprehensive understanding of the language and prepare you for the exam. Numerous language schools and online platforms provide courses specifically tailored to the Goethe B1 level.
Practice Tests: Taking practice tests is essential to familiarize yourself with the exam format and identify locations that require improvement. The Goethe-Institut provides sample tests and practice materials on their site.
Reading and Listening: Regularly checking out German texts and listening to German audio can improve your understanding skills. Resources such as news posts, podcasts, and books are valuable for this function.
Composing and Speaking: Practice writing essays and letters in German, and talk with native speakers or language partners. This will help you refine your writing and speaking skills.
Vocabulary and Grammar: Building a strong vocabulary and mastering German grammar are important. Use flashcards, grammar exercises, and language apps to boost your knowledge.
Frequently asked questions about the Goethe B1 Certification
Q: How long does it take to get ready for the Goethe B1 exam?A: The preparation time can differ depending on your current level of German efficiency and the quantity of time you can devote to studying. Normally, it takes a number of months of consistent practice to reach the B1 level.
Q: Can I take the Goethe B1 exam online?A: Yes, the Goethe-Institut uses online versions of the B1 exam. Nevertheless, the accessibility of online examinations may differ by location, so it's best to talk to your regional Goethe-Institut for more details.
Q: What is the passing score for the Goethe B1 exam?A: To pass the Goethe B1 exam, you need to score at least 60% in each section of the exam. The overall rating is determined based on the efficiency in all 4 sections.
Q: Can I retake the Goethe B1 exam if I don't pass?A: Yes, you can retake the exam as lot of times as essential. Nevertheless, there might be a waiting period in between efforts, and you will require to pay the exam fee each time you retake it.
Q: Is the Goethe B1 accreditation legitimate for life?A: Yes, the Goethe B1 certification stands for life. As soon as you pass the exam, you do not need to retake it to maintain your accreditation.
